Output 21f38c729133aaf3ed19e4e41eb4b65e9d649e22fac6b35e6987557c83c8bb1e:0

value
75405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b19eb88a2941745348dad6082ace18f9d1a92b6b OP_EQUALVERIFY OP_CHECKSIG
address
1HCAk5D3b8qEJDfajEmh2ZfyYT1bqKGqs2
transaction
21f38c729133aaf3ed19e4e41eb4b65e9d649e22fac6b35e6987557c83c8bb1e
spent
true